- What is Avery Dennison's total current liabilities?
- Avery Dennison (AVY) reported total current liabilities of $2.8B in Q1 2026.
- How has Avery Dennison's total current liabilities changed year-over-year?
- Avery Dennison's total current liabilities decreased by 5.2% year-over-year, from $2.95B to $2.8B.
- What is the long-term trend for Avery Dennison's total current liabilities?
- Over 5 years (2020 to 2025), Avery Dennison's total current liabilities has grown at a 6.6%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$1.93B to $2.65B.
- What does total current liabilities mean?
- The total amount of debt and obligations due within the next year.
- How do you interpret total current liabilities?
- A rising trend relative to current assets may signal liquidity stress, while a stable ratio indicates healthy working capital management.
- How does total current liabilities compare across companies?
- Used to calculate the current ratio; compared against industry peers to assess short-term financial health.
